1 Hospitalized After Stabbing In Meriden: Police
Police responded to a report of an assault-in-progress, according to officials.
MERIDEN, CT — One person was hospitalized after being stabbed late Saturday night in Meriden, according to police.
Police responded to Willow Street around 11:10 p.m. on May 31 on the report of an assault-in-progress, according to Lt. Darrin McKay.
McKay said officers found a victim with two stab wounds.

The victim was taken to Hartford Hospital for treatment of their injuries, according to McKay.
McKay said the victim was expected to survive.

Police are continuing to investigate the stabbing.
Anyone with information is asked to contact Det. Daniel McKenna at dmckenna@meridenct.gov or 203-630-6284.
